    Took the ride up here from Phoenix via Bumble Bee. I have been here before so was prepared for the limited choices available for dining. On a whim we decided to go here rather than the Saloon. I can't compare them since I have not been to the saloon. The place was built in the 1990's, but looks like it has been here forever. Unpretentious and lots of fun stuff to look at. On to the food. The couple at the next table said the green chile was outstanding, and was it ever! Lots of chunky beef and veggies and a delicious flavor. A must order. Two of us had hamburgers which are ground in house. Topped with everything it was delicious and cooked to a perfect medium. Plenty of avocado, perfectly cooked bacon and grilled onions that are to die for. Served on your choice of home baked bread. The fries were fresh cut and fried to golden perfection. The other thing ordered was the grilled cheese, which was huge and very crispy. It was not crowded mid afternoon on a Fri., and we got very friendly and helpful service from Audra. Give this place a try. I think you will be pleased with the overall "real" AZ experience. Say hi to Audra if you go.
